Next Xbox - No Disc Drive?
http://www.mcvuk.com/news/read/exclusive...box/092534

Quote:MCV has learnt that Microsoft has been telling partners that the Next Xbox will NOT include a disc drive.

...

Although the console will not include a disc drive, it will offer compatibility with some sort of interchangeable solid-state card storage, although it is not known whether this will be proprietary or a more standard format such as SD.

...
Furthermore, a 2013 launch date for the hardware has been confirmed...

...

The omission of a disc drive signifies the beginning of a new era for games consoles and represents a potentially savage blow to the already beleaguered video games retail sector.
